ComicFury features and specs

  • User-Friendly Interface
    ComicFury offers a straightforward and easy-to-navigate interface, allowing creators to easily set up and manage their webcomics without needing extensive technical knowledge.
  • Free Hosting
    The platform provides free hosting for webcomics, making it accessible for creators at any budget level to share their work online.
  • Customizability
    ComicFury allows users to customize the appearance of their webcomic pages with various templates and HTML/CSS editing capabilities, giving creators creative control over the presentation of their work.
  • Community Interaction
    The site integrates community features such as comment sections, forums, and a community hub, fostering interaction and feedback between creators and readers.
  • Multiple Comic Management
    Creators can manage multiple comics from a single account, providing a convenient solution for those with several ongoing projects.

Possible disadvantages of ComicFury

  • Limited Monetization Options
    ComicFury does not offer extensive built-in monetization tools, which may require creators to seek external platforms to establish a revenue stream from their webcomics.
  • Less Traffic Compared to Major Platforms
    Although ComicFury has a dedicated community, it doesn't boast the same level of traffic or exposure as larger webcomic platforms, which might limit discoverability for new creators.
  • Learning Curve for Customization
    While the platform offers customization abilities, those without HTML/CSS experience may find the process of customizing their comic pages challenging initially.
  • Potentially Dated Design Elements
    Some users may find certain design aspects of ComicFury's platform to be outdated compared to more modern webcomic websites, which can affect user experience.
  • Dependency on External Tools for Advanced Features
    For advanced comic features like analytics or integrated subscription services, creators might need to rely on external tools and services, as ComicFury doesn't provide comprehensive in-built solutions.

  • Chapter 02 pg 164
    Uhhh so on Comic Fury (the platform that hosts our comic's main site) there's the option to include a transcript, which is intended to just be so you can make your comic's dialogue searchable, if you enable the search function on your comic's site. Source: over 3 years ago
  • Any fan-comic writers?
    Heck yeah fan comic artist here! You'll find more of us on ComicFury. I wished there was more of us also on AO3, but it's formatting doesn't really make it easy lol. Source: almost 4 years ago
  • Is there a platform for more mature webcomics than Webtoon's?
    However, ComicFury is a good site for posting mature comics, I've found. There's a very extensive tagging & filtering system, so the site isn't as worried about little kids coming across mature content accidentally. Source: about 4 years ago
  • You know of a good community of older comic creators?
    I dunno if this is what you're looking for- but a couple of months ago I found this site: Comicfury to host my comics because all the big ones favor scroll and I like page format. There are teenagers there on the forums but the average age of forum participants is 20-40 (with a lot of over/under) and it has a very active forum section. Source: about 4 years ago
  • To all writers who post fanfics on unconventional websites (sites that aren't AO3, FF.Net, or Wattpad), what's it like, why do you do it, and what site do you post your fics to?
    Because my preferred way to tell stories is comics. As much as I love AO3, it's not comic-friendly. Thus my main place to read/post is Comic Fury. Source: about 4 years ago
